The Certified Specialist Programme in Gender Bias in Criminal Justice is increasingly significant in today’s market. The UK faces a persistent challenge regarding gender inequality within its justice system. Recent studies reveal alarming disparities. For example, women are disproportionately represented in certain categories of crime (e.g., domestic abuse) while experiencing under-reporting and inadequate support. Similarly, male victims of gender-based violence often face societal stigmas that impede their access to justice. Understanding these biases and implementing effective strategies for fairer outcomes is crucial.
